Oven Roasted Brussels Sprout with Bacon

I love me some Brussels sprouts steamed as they are with a little butter and salt and pepper… Unfortunately the hubby doesn’t. But once I added some bacon, a little garlic, honey and grainy mustard, it’s like he forgot he was eating those “yucky” vegetables.


INGREDIENTS
2lbs Brussels sprouts
4-5 slices of Bacon, diced
1/2 large Red Onion, sliced
2 tbsp Olive Oil
6 cloves Garlic, minced
2 tbsp Grainy Mustard
2 tbsp Honey
1 tsp Smoked Paprika
½ tsp Sea Salt
½ tsp freshly cracked black pepper

DIRECTIONS

Preheat oven to 425F. Trim the ends off the Brussels sprouts and cut them in half. Place them in a large mixing bowl along with the onion. Sprinkle bacon over the sprouts.

In a seperate container, mix olive oil, garlic, mustard, honey, smoked paprika, salt and pepper. Mix until very well combined and pour over reserved sprouts and bacon. Mix to coat evenly and spread in a single layer in a shallow baking dish sprayed with cooking oil.

Place in the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, turning once or twice, until the sprouts are tender and golden and the bacon is crispy.
